สื่อสารยุคใหม่กับ twitter ตอนที่ 2 twitter กับ Google Latitude

คราวก่อนได้เขียนถึง twitter ในฐานะของการสนทนาคล้ายๆกับที่เราใช้งาน MSN Messenger มาคราวนี้จะเป็นเรื่องราวของ twitter ที่ไม่เกี่ยวกับการสนทนาโดยตรงครับ ที่ว่าไม่เกี่ยวกับการสนทนโดยตรงเพราะ twitter มีบทบาทที่นอกเหนือไปจากการสนทนาก็คือ
Status update คือการเปิดเผยข้อมูลของเราที่ต้องการเปิดเผยให้เพื่อนของเราทราบ เช่นตอนนี้กำลังทำอะไรอยู่ ตอนนี้อยู่ที่ไหน สำหรับสถานการณ์ที่เราไม่ต้องระมัดระวังตัวนัก และให้เพื่อนๆได้มีส่วนร่วมในชีวิตเรา (และในทางกลับกัน เราได้มีส่วนร่วมกับชีวิตเพื่อน) ได้มากขึ้น แม้จะไม่ได้อยู่ใกล้กัน แต่ก็ได้รับรู้เรื่องราวของกันและกันได้มากขึ้น
Microblogging คือเขียนเกี่ยวกับความคิดของเราขณะนั้นด้วยข้อความไม่เกิน 140 ตัวอักษร คล้ายๆกับที่รายการคุยข่าวให้ส่ง SMS มาร่วมรายการครับ แต่ของ twitter คนที่อ่านความเห็นของเราจะเป็นแวดวงที่เราติดต่อกัน การทำ Microblogging จะได้พบบ่อยๆระหว่างช่วงเวลาแข่งบอล หรือช่วงเวลาของรายการ Academy Fantasia หรือแม้แต่ช่วงข่าวเช้า อ่านความเห็นประกอบข่าวกันให้ครึกครื้น

สำหรับตอนนี้เป็นการนำเอา twitter มาใช้ร่วมกับ Google Latitude ในรูปแบบของ Status update ครับ และเป็นการ Update โดยอัตโนมัติโดยใช้ข้อมูลสถานที่ที่เราอยู่ เรียกว่าเป็นเทคโนโลยีกลุ่ม Location Awareness ครับ การใช้งานลักษณะนี้ เราจะต้องมีชื่อ twitter และใช้งาน Google Latitude อยู่แล้วนะครับ (อ่านบทความ Google Latidue ได้ที่นี่ครับ) เมื่อนำมารวมกัน ระบบนี้จะ Tweet ให้เราโดยอัตโนมัติว่า ขณะนี้เราอยู่ที่ไหน โดยจะบอกเป็นชื่อของสถานที่เลยครับ เช่นอยู่ที่กรุงเทพฯ อยู่ที่ศรีราชา ฯลฯ เพื่อให้คนที่เราห่วงใย หรือเพื่อนที่รอนัดหมายได้ทราบว่าขณะนี้เรามาถึงไหนแล้ว
แต่ก่อนที่เราจะไปถึงจุดนั้น ต้องมีการเตรียมการอีกพอสมควรครับ นั่นคือจะต้องมีเว็บอีกสามเว็บที่ทำหน้าที่อ่านข้อมูลจาก Google Latitude เป็นระยะๆ และนำมา Tweet แทนเรา

เป็นบริการของ Yahoo! เขาครับ FireEagle เป็นบริการ Location-Based ทำหน้าที่เป็นสื่อกลางระหว่างบริการต่างๆรวมทั้ง Google Latitude และ twitter ด้วยให้แลกเปลี่ยนข้อมูลกัน
หากเราใช้บริการของ Yahoo! อยู่แล้วก็ใช้ Account ของเราเข้าใช้บริการ FireEagle ได้เลยครับ ถ้ายังไม่มี ก็ต้อง Sign Up สร้าง Account ใหม่กัน

ถัดจาก FireEagle ซึ่งทำหน้าที่เป็นตัวกลางแล้ว คราวนี้ก็เป็นตัวที่เชื่อมโยงเอาข้อมูลจาก Google Latitude มาสู่ FireEagle ครับ
จัดการ Sign up แล้วมาที่ Source เพื่อกำหนดแหล่งข้อมูล

เลือก FireEagle เพื่อให้ map me ส่งข้อมูลไปให้
เพื่อนๆจะสังเกตเห็นว่ามี Logo ของ twitter ที่หน้านี้ด้วย แต่อันนี้จะไว้สำหรับให้ twitter เป็นแหล่งข้อมูลครับ คือสามารถส่ง Direct Message เข้ามากำหนดได้ด้วยตัวเราว่าจะกำหนดตำแหน่งของเราไว้ที่ไหน
ในกรณีที่เราจะกำหนดตำแหน่งโดยอัตโนมัติ เราจะไม่ Setup ตรงนี้ก็ได้ครับ

คราวนี้มาดูที่ Google Latitude ครับ เปิด Browser ใหม่ขึ้นมา แล้วไปที่ http://www.google.com/latitude/apps/badge ดูที่บรรทัดล่างๆแล้ว Copy เอาข้อมูล Public JSON Feed มาใส่ในหน้าของ map me ครับ
อย่าลืมคลิก Update ด้วยนะครับ
เอาล่ะ ตอนนี้เราก็มีข้อมูลจาก Google Latitude เข้ามาที่ FireEagle โดยผ่าน map me แล้วครับ ซึ่งทั้งหมดนี้จะคอยตามดูพิกัดตำแหน่งของเราเป็นระยะๆ ถ้าเรามี Application อื่นที่เรียกใช้ข้อมูลจาก FireEagle เช่น Friends on Fire! บน Facebook ก็จะมีพิกัดของเราขึ้นบนแผนที่ให้เพื่อนๆตามได้
แต่คราวนี้เราไม่ได้ไปที่ Facebook นะครับ เราจะหาอะไรที่เอาข้อมูลพิกัดของเราเนี่ย Tweet บอกเพื่อนๆ ไม่ต้องให้เขามาที่ Facebook

ตัวนี้จะเป็น FireEagle application ตัวหนึ่งที่จะมา Tweet ตำแหน่งให้เราครับ
เราไม่ต้อง Sign up สำหรับ EagleTweet ครับ สามารถใช้ OpenID ซึ่งสำหรับกรณีนี้ ก็เอา Yahoo! email address ของเรานี่แหละ Sign in แล้ว Setup ได้เลย
จากนั้นก็จะมีขั้นตอนการเชื่อมต่อกับ FireEagle และ twitter ให้เรา
เรียบร้อยแล้วครับ จากนี้ไป พอเราเดินทาง เปลี่ยนสถานที่ ระบบที่เรา Setup ไว้นี้ก็จะตรวจดูว่าเราออกจากพื้นที่เดิม จากนั้นก็จะ Tweet พื้นที่ใหม่ให้เพื่อนๆของเราได้ทราบว่า เราขยับมาที่ใหม่แล้วนะ
เพียงแต่ว่า ถ้าเป็นกรุงเทพฯ มันไม่ค่อยบอกว่าอยู่แขวงไหนเขตไหนครับ ว่ากันแต่ I am in Bangkok ท่าเดียว จึงเหมาะกับเพื่อนๆที่เดินทางต่างจังหวัดหรือต่างประเทศบ่อยๆมากกว่า เพราะถ้าอยู่แต่ในกรุงเทพฯจะไม่ค่อยได้เห็น Tweet สถานที่ของเรา
แน่นอนครับ หากเราตั้งพิกัดของเราที่ Google Latitude แบบ Manual ไว้ สถานที่ที่ EagleTweet จะส่งมา ก็จะเป็นสถานที่เดียวกับที่เราตั้งใน Google Latitude
คืออาจจะไม่ใช่สถานที่จริงที่เราอยู่ จนกว่าเราจะปรับ Google Latitude มาเป็นแบบอัตโนมัติ แต่ใช้สำหรับทดสอบระบบของเราได้นะครับ จับย้ายสถานที่เอาดื้อๆแล้วรอดูว่าระบบนี้จะ Tweet อะไรออกมาบ้าง
ก็คงจะทำให้เพื่อนๆได้สนุกกับบริการในกลุ่ม Location Awareness ร่วมกับ twitter เพื่อสื่อสารกับกลุ่มเพื่อนได้หลากหลายขึ้นนะครับ









Recent comments
9 weeks 2 days ago
11 weeks 4 days ago
14 weeks 1 day ago
15 weeks 2 days ago
17 weeks 6 days ago
17 weeks 6 days ago
19 weeks 6 days ago
22 weeks 4 days ago
22 weeks 5 days ago
22 weeks 5 days ago